Background technique
Highway monitoring system is mainly responsible for data, video, the information collection of road conditions, processing and storage, provides traffic Information resources, for highway quickly, safety, comfortable, efficient operation provide safeguard.For the speed and vehicle of driving vehicle Between the monitoring of spacing be one of emphasis, spacing refers to front vehicle in order to avoid accident collision occurs with front vehicles And the necessary spacing distance kept under steam with front vehicles.Keeping safe distance between vehicles is to prevent rear-end collision most directly, most Effectively, most extensive and the most fundamental method.At present frequently with mode be by outdoor traffic guidance screen, it is defeated under different speeds Different range line values achievees the purpose that safe driving to remind driver to control spacing and speed under steam out.In the prior art By setting earth inductor to monitor speed and spacing, but earth inductor is to calculate front and back vehicle based on single-point vehicle speed value Spacing, design conditions are in the following distance of front and back, and front truck travel speed value is constant.If calculating in distance, preceding vehicle velocity value There are variations, then calculated front and back following distance value and practical following distance value can have deviation.

Fig. 1 and Fig. 2 are please referred to, the embodiment of the present application provides a kind of spacing monitoring device 10, the spacing monitoring dress Setting 10 includes microwave monitor 300, picture pick-up device 200, control host 100 and display equipment 400.The picture pick-up device 200, The microwave monitor 300 and the display equipment 400 are respectively arranged on the bracket above road.Wherein, for the ease of Accurate measurement, can be respectively set a microwave monitor 300, pointedly on affiliated lane on each lane Vehicle is monitored.The coverage of picture pick-up device 200 is wider, and therefore, a settable picture pick-up device 200 can take respectively Certainly a picture pick-up device 200 can also be respectively set, to this in the image information of vehicle on lane above each lane This embodiment is not specifically limited.The display equipment 400 is arranged from the microwave monitor 300 and the picture pick-up device Above 200 roads being spaced a distance.Wherein, as shown in Figure 2, the microwave monitor 300 and the picture pick-up device 200 Setting towards consistent with the direction of vehicle driving on lane, the display equipment 400 is oriented vehicle driving on lane Opposite direction.
The picture pick-up device 200 is connect with the microwave monitor 300 and the control host 100 respectively, the control Host 100 is also connect with the display equipment 400.Wherein, the control host 100 may include bnc interface, RJ-45 interface or AUI interface etc..It can be connected by cable between the control host 100 and the picture pick-up device 200 and the display equipment 400 It connects, such as twisted pair, coaxial cable or optical cable.Signal can be passed through between the picture pick-up device 200 and the microwave monitor 300 Line connection.
The microwave monitor 300 can be used for monitoring lane uplink into vehicle adjacent two vehicle of vehicle speed value and front and back Spacing value between.The microwave monitor 300 is emitted by calculating electromagnetic wave from monitor, is returned after tested vehicle reflects The monitor is calculated to the time difference used in monitor the distance between to tested vehicle, to obtain adjacent two vehicle in front and back Spacing value between.
The microwave monitor 300 can determine that the spacing value between two vehicles monitored whether be maintained at default safety away from From if the spacing value between two vehicle of front and back monitored is less than default safe distance, microwave monitor 300 can trigger described The candid photograph of picture pick-up device 200 obtains the image information of target vehicle in adjacent two vehicle, wherein the target vehicle is adjacent two vehicle In be in rear vehicle.

Under different weather conditions, speed and spacing for vehicle have different requirements, such as in foggy weather Under, the spacing value between vehicle should keep larger, unexpected to avoid occurring under this bad weather.
In view of above situation, in the present embodiment, the spacing monitoring device 10 further includes weather monitoring device 700, institute It states weather monitoring device 700 to connect with the control host 100, weather monitoring device 700 can pass through signal wire and the control Host 100 connects.The weather monitoring device 700 may be disposed at by road, for monitoring the Weather information in set section, And the Weather information monitored is sent to the control host 100.
The control host 100 can obtain corresponding standard vehicle away from value and standard speed according to the Weather information received Value, that is, the vehicle speed value and spacing value that are suitable under current state of weather.The control host 100 can be by the standard vehicle Fast value and standard vehicle are sent to the display equipment 400 away from value to be shown, to provide speed for driver, spacing refers to Value.In this way, driver can be by speed and spacing that the information in observation display equipment 400 is currently suitable for, correspondingly to adjust The travel speed of vehicle and the distance between with front truck, to avoid vehicle collision phenomenon occurs.
In the present embodiment, the brightness value of display equipment 400 can adjust accordingly according to different weather conditions, in order to take charge of Machine clearly, can be watched cosily.Optionally, the control host 100 can be sent corresponding bright according to the Weather information received Regulating command is spent to the display equipment 400, and the display equipment 400 can instruct according to the brightness regulation and adjust itself display Brightness value.For example, the brightness value of display equipment 400 also should be lightened correspondingly in the stronger situation of fine, light, keep away Exempt from not seeing the display information in Chu's display equipment 400 in the stronger situation of light.And the feelings weaker in rainy weather, light Under condition, the brightness value for showing equipment 400 can be turned down accordingly, the viewing of driver is not on the one hand influenced, on the other hand can save Amount of equipment power consumption.
Optionally, referring to Fig. 4, in the present embodiment, the weather monitoring device 700 include visibility monitor 710, Tipping bucket rain gauge 720, air velocity transducer 730, wind transducer 740, temperature sensor 750 and humidity sensor At least one of 760.The visibility monitor 710, tipping bucket rain gauge 720, air velocity transducer 730, wind direction pass Sensor 740, temperature sensor 750 and humidity sensor 760 are connect with the control host 100 respectively.Wherein, the temperature Sensor 750 and the humidity sensor 760 can be used for acquiring temperature value in current road conditions weather and humidity value to reflect road With the presence or absence of situations such as icings on face, the visibility monitor 710 is used to detect the visibility information of current weather to reflect Whether current road conditions there is dense fog etc..The tipping bucket rain gauge 720 is for acquiring rainfall data to reflect current road conditions Rainfall etc..
